Alvernia University Drama & Theater Arts Bachelor’s Degrees

In the most recent year for which we have data, Alvernia University conferred 2 bachelor’s degrees in drama & theater arts.

Alvernia University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

$45,000 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

The full-time undergraduate tuition and fees are shown below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$37,780 $43,000
Fees $2,000 $2,000
